Why Choose PEEK for 3D Printing?

PEEK additive manufacturing combines high-temperature performance with the design flexibility of 3D printing. It enables lightweight parts, complex internal features and consolidated assemblies without dedicated tooling, making it suitable for prototypes, customised components and low-volume production. In medical applications, patient-specific designs can also be produced from imaging data, subject to material grade, process validation and regulatory requirements.

ZYPEEK

PEEK retains strong mechanical properties at elevated temperatures and offers low flammability and smoke generation. Depending on the grade and test thickness, it can meet UL 94 V-0 requirements, making PEEK suitable for 3D-printed components in high-temperature and safety-critical applications.

ZYPEEK

PEEK offers a strong balance of tensile strength, stiffness, toughness and creep resistance. It can retain mechanical performance under elevated temperatures and repeated loading, supporting the production of functional 3D-printed parts for demanding structural and dynamic applications.

ZYPEEK

PEEK provides low friction and good wear resistance, making it suitable for 3D-printed bearings, seals, gears and other moving components. With the right grade and operating conditions, it can support dry-running designs and replace selected metal parts to reduce weight and lubrication needs.

ZYPEEK

PEEK combines dielectric strength and volume resistivity with resistance to heat, pressure and moisture. These characteristics support 3D-printed electrical connectors, insulating components and housings for industrial, aerospace and other demanding applications.

ZYPEEK

PEEK resists many chemicals, fuels, oils and hydrolysis, with compatibility depending on the specific medium and operating conditions. Low moisture absorption and a low coefficient of thermal expansion help maintain dimensional stability, while selected grades also offer ionising radiation resistance for aerospace, medical and energy applications.

ZYPEEK

Additive manufacturing enables complex geometries, internal channels and multiple parts to be consolidated into a single component. With suitable equipment, process settings and post-processing, PEEK can produce accurate, repeatable functional parts while reducing assembly steps.

Medical: Patient-Specific Devices and Implants

Medical-grade PEEK is used in selected orthopaedic, spinal and cranial applications due to its radiolucency and bone-like modulus. Additive manufacturing enables patient-specific geometries and porous structures while reducing material waste. Medical use requires the appropriate grade, validated processes and regulatory approval.

Aerospace: Lightweight Integrated Components

PEEK and PEEK composites offer low weight with heat, chemical and radiation resistance for aerospace applications. Additive manufacturing enables complex ducts, brackets, housings and integrated features that can be difficult or costly to produce conventionally.

Industrial: Functional Parts and Tooling

For industrial manufacturing, PEEK 3D printing can produce functional prototypes, jigs, fixtures, seals, wear components and electrical-insulation parts. Tool-free production can shorten lead times for low-volume components and make complex or lightweight designs commercially practical.
